The present invention will be further explained with reference to the accompanying drawings and specific embodiments, as shown in fig. 1-5, according to the brake machine for intelligent parking of the embodiment of the present invention, the brake machine comprises a brake machine case 1, a camera 2, an alarm 3, a LED light supplement lamp 4 and a door 5 are sequentially arranged on the front side of the brake machine case 1, a lock hole 6 is arranged on the surface of the door 5, and a control box 7 is arranged at the inner bottom of the brake machine case 1; the interior top of floodgate machine case 1 is provided with brake lever drive assembly 8, and brake lever drive assembly 8's top is connected with brake lever subassembly 9, and one side of brake lever subassembly 9 is provided with two sets of distance inductors 10, and one side that brake lever subassembly 9 kept away from floodgate machine case 1 is provided with the brake lever and places subassembly 11.
By means of the above technical scheme, through control box 7 and camera 2, alarm 3, apart from inductor 10, display 14, license plate discernment camera 15, brake lever drive assembly 8 and brake lever subassembly 9 electricity are connected, the intelligent management to the floodgate machine device has been realized, the in-process that the vehicle went out need not artificial operation, and then artificial working strength has been reduced, through setting up brake lever subassembly 9, make the driver of being convenient for under the lower circumstances of visibility such as cloudy day or night see the position clearly.
In one embodiment, for the gate case 1, a base 12 is arranged on one side of the gate case 1, a column 13 is connected to the top end of the base 12, a display 14 is arranged on the outer side of the column 13, and a license plate recognition camera 15 is arranged on the top end of the column 13; the top of floodgate machine case 1 is provided with baffle 16 through the bracing piece to make and to protect the equipment on floodgate machine case 1 surface through baffle 16 when rainy day, avoid taking place to damage and cause the damage of floodgate machine.
In an embodiment, for the brake lever driving assembly 8, the brake lever driving assembly 8 includes a mounting cavity 801 mounted at the inner top of the brake cabinet 1, a motor 802 is disposed at one side of the mounting cavity 801, an output shaft of the motor 802 is connected with a rotating shaft 803, a first bevel gear 804 is disposed at the outer side of the rotating shaft 803, a second bevel gear 805 engaged with the first bevel gear 804 is disposed at one side of the first bevel gear 804, and a connecting rod 806 is disposed at the middle of the second bevel gear 805, so that the brake lever can be lifted under the driving of the motor 802, the manual operation is reduced, and the workload of workers is reduced. In addition, in order to ensure the stability of the brake lever driving assembly 8 during specific use, the motor 802 adopts a servo motor including a speed reducer.
In one embodiment, for the above-mentioned brake lever assembly 9, the brake lever assembly 9 includes a brake lever 901 mounted on one side of the connecting rod 806, a plurality of sets of light emitting elements 902 are mounted on both sides of the brake lever 901, and a shielding plate 903 is disposed outside the light emitting elements 902, so that the driver can see the position of the brake lever 901 clearly in case of low visibility such as cloudy day or night, and the risk of collision with the brake lever 901 is avoided.
In one embodiment, for the brake lever placing assembly 11, the brake lever placing assembly 11 includes a fixing plate 1101 installed at one side of the brake cabinet 1, a fixing rod 1102 is disposed at a top end of the fixing plate 1101, an installation groove 1103 is disposed at a middle portion of a top end of the fixing rod 1102, a plurality of sets of compression springs 1104 are disposed inside the installation groove 1103, a lifting lever 1105 is disposed at a top end of the fixing rod 1102, and a bottom end of the lifting lever 1105 is installed inside the installation groove 1103; the brake lever placing assembly 11 further comprises a supporting frame 1106 installed at the top end of the lifting rod 1105, and the supporting frame 1106 is of a U-shaped structure, so that the brake lever 901 is inserted into the supporting frame 1106 in the descending process, the supporting frame 1106 extrudes the compression spring 1104 in the fixing rod 1102 through the lifting rod 1105, the compression spring 1104 can buffer the inertia of the brake lever 901, the damage caused by the over-high descending speed of the brake lever 901 is avoided, and the service life of the brake is prolonged.
For the convenience of understanding the technical solution of the present invention, the following detailed description is made on the working principle or the operation mode of the present invention in the practical process.
In practical application, a gate installer is electrically connected with the camera 2, the alarm 3, the distance sensor 10, the display 14, the license plate recognition camera 15, the motor 802 and the light-emitting element 902 through the control box 7, and when the gate installer is used, the automatic control system master switch of the camera 2, the alarm 3, the distance sensor 10, the display 14, the license plate recognition camera 15, the motor 802 and the light-emitting element 902 is turned on through the control box 7.
Before a driver drives a vehicle to arrive at a gate, the vehicle to be driven out is identified through the license plate identification camera 15, after the verification is passed, the distance of the vehicle is detected through the distance sensor 10, if the distance is too close and the brake lever 901 is not lifted, a signal is sent to the control box 7 and is transmitted to the data collector and the power controller, then a switch of the alarm 3 is opened to send out an alarm, the driver and workers are reminded to avoid collision on the brake lever 901 to cause damage, otherwise, the brake lever driving assembly 8 is used for realizing the functions of lifting and falling of the brake lever 901, when the driver drives the vehicle out, the brake lever 901 is placed when falling, and then the brake lever placing assembly 11 is used for protecting the brake lever 901 to avoid damage. The utility model provides a camera 2, alarm 3, apart from inductor 10, display 14, license plate discernment camera 15, motor 802 and light emitting component 902, data collection station, power controller and circuit master switch are the product of selling on the market, and electric connected mode is traditional structure, can refer to prior art, so do not do too much here and describe.
The working principle of the brake lever driving assembly 8 is as follows: the motor 802 is started through the control box 7 to drive the first bevel gear 804 to rotate, and then the second bevel gear 805 drives the connecting rod 806 to rotate, so that the brake rod 901 connected with the connecting rod can be driven to realize the lifting and falling functions.
The working principle of the brake lever assembly 9 is as follows: when the gate bar 901 is lifted, the display 14 displays a passage indicator, and the light emitting element 902 emits green light to indicate passage, but when the gate bar 901 is placed horizontally, the display 14 displays a passage prohibition indicator, and the light emitting element 902 emits red light to indicate passage prohibition, so that the driver can see the position of the gate bar 901 clearly in a low visibility condition such as cloudy day or night, and the danger of collision with the gate bar 901 is avoided.
The working principle of the brake lever placing assembly 11 is as follows: after the vehicle is driven out, the brake bar 901 is inserted into the support frame 1106 in the descending process, the support frame 1106 extrudes the compression spring 1104 in the fixing rod 1102 through the lifting rod 1105, the compression spring 1104 can buffer the inertia of the brake bar 901, the damage caused by the over-high descending speed of the brake bar 901 is avoided, and the service life of the brake is further prolonged.
